what to wear
- Keep It Simple & Professional (for Corporate/Office roles).
- Solid colours photograph best
- Avoid busy patterns, tiny stripes or loud prints.
- Choose classic pieces over trend-driven outfits will ensure your image stays current for longer.
Great colour options:
- Navy
- Charcoal
- Mid-grey
- Soft blue
- Emerald
- Deep burgundy
- Cream (layered under darker tones)
Avoid:
- Neon colours
- Large logos
- Very thin stripes (can cause distortion)
- Overly shiny fabrics
Outfit Tips for Women
- Structured blazers elevate any look.
- A well-fitted blouse in a solid tone works beautifully.
- Simple jewellery (studs, delicate necklace) keeps the focus on your face.
- Bring two outfit options if you’re unsure — we can decide together.
OUTFIT TIPS FOR men
- A tailored jacket instantly sharpens your look.
- Crisp collared shirts (white, light blue, soft grey) are timeless.
- Tie or no tie? It depends on your industry — bring both if you’d like options.
- Avoid creased shirts — iron the night before.
